The Value of Preventative Maintenance in Commercial and Strata Buildings

Preventative maintenance is one of the most effective ways to protect property investments and avoid costly emergency repairs. Rather than reacting to failures, proactive maintenance identifies potential risks early and addresses them before they escalate.

Waterproofing systems, sealants, joints, and structural coatings naturally degrade over time due to weather exposure, movement, and general wear. Regular inspections and maintenance help extend their lifespan and maintain building performance.

For strata managers and commercial property owners, preventative maintenance reduces unexpected repair costs, improves tenant satisfaction, and supports long-term asset value. It also helps maintain compliance with building regulations and safety standards.

Routine inspections can identify early signs of water ingress, structural movement, surface deterioration, and material fatigue. Addressing these issues early often involves minor repairs rather than major reconstruction, resulting in significant cost savings.

Preventative maintenance also contributes to sustainability by reducing material waste and prolonging the life of existing structures. This approach aligns with modern construction practices focused on durability and lifecycle performance.
